Schlep (2016)
This weekend is going to be awkward - and it's all Scott's fault.
Spend the weekend with Scott as he goes to the desert to reclaim his girlfriend from a "misunderstanding." Along the way, he must duck and dodge her nunchuck-wielding brother, bond with his newly married best friend, and witness a meddling reiki enthusiast attempt to wreck their marriage...again.
Director: Scott Dunn
Genre: Comedy
Runtime: 84 min
Release Date: June 1, 2016
